Saltar al contenido principal

Blogshare

Ir a buscar
Inicio
Trabajo
Ocio
BlogShare
Documentación
En Venta o Cambio
  

...Mas emplea más cuidado quien se quiere aventajar .... > Blogshare > Entradas de blog > Arquitectura de Sharepoint Server 2010
Arquitectura de Sharepoint Server 2010

Aún me acuerdo cuando procedíamos a crear un “portal” en Sharepoint Portal Server 2003. Se nos generaban tres bases de datos para dar soporte a los aspectos funcionales específicos de la aplicación. _SITE para el contenido de la base de datos, _SERV para la configuración de servicios y _PROF para la configuración de perfiles de base de datos. En Sharepoint Server 2007, se afianzó el concepto de Proveedor de Servicios Compartidos, donde una aplicación web se encontraba en el ámbito de un proveedor específico formando parte como consumidora de los servicios que éste proporcionaba. Pues bien, Sharepoint Server 2010 cambia de nuevo a nivel de arquitectura, presentando la idea o el concepto de Aplicaciones de Servicio, mediante una nueva infraestructura de servicios.

Los cambios a asimilar son:

  • Ya NO se da continuidad al Proveedor de Servicios Compartidos.
  • A nivel de arquitectura lógica, ahora se ofrece una configuración granular de servicios a través del nuevo concepto de Aplicaciones de Servicio.
  • Una Aplicación de Servicio es un servicio desplegado en una granja, permitiendo que las aplicaciones web puedan utilizar sólo los servicios que necesitan, pudiendo compartir entre si dichas aplicaciones de servicio.
  • Se pueden implementar varias instancias del mismo servicio en una granja de servidores y asignar nombres únicos a las aplicaciones de servicio que se obtienen como resultado.
  • Una Aplicación de Servicio proporciona nivel de aislamiento de procesos, permitiendo crear una aplicación de servicio en diferentes grupos de aplicaciones.
  • Algunas Aplicaciones de Servicio pueden compartirse entre diferentes granjas de servidores (Cross-Farm Services), mientras que otras Aplicaciones de Servicio sólo se pueden utilizar de forma local en la granja en la que se encuentren.
  • Las aplicaciones de servicio son desplegadas en la capa del servidor de aplicación.

Según esto, los diagramas de Microsoft para arquitectura de granja única nos presentan varias topologías de implantación:

a) Single Farm con single service group:

►Descripción:

  • El grupo por defecto de servicios se utiliza para todas las aplicaciones web en una granja.
  • Todos los sitios tienen acceso a todas las aplicaciones de servicio que se despliegan en la granja.

►Ventajas:

  • Estructura simple.
  • Todos los servicios se encuentran disponibles en todas las aplicaciones web.
  • Mejor uso eficaz de los recursos de la granja.
  • Todos los servicios son gestionados centralizadamente

►Inconvenientes:

  • No permite aislamiento de los datos de servicio.
  • Departamentos individuales o grupos no pueden administrar sus propias aplicaciones de servicio.

►Recomendaciones:

  • Configuración recomendada para la mayoría de las empresas.
  • Configuración idónea para un gran número de sitios para una única empresa en una granja

image

b) Single Farm con múltiples service group

►Descripción:

  • Las aplicaciones de servicios son desplegadas para uso dedicado en uno o más grupos en una organización.
  • Las aplicaciones web son creadas pudiendo utilizar grupos personalizados de aplicaciones de servicio.
  • Se pueden crear varios grupos personalizados de aplicaciones de servicio.
  • Se puede establecer aislamiento de procesos al permitir desplegar grupos personalizados de aplicaciones de servicios en grupos de aplicaciones (Application Pool) independientes.

►Ventanas:

  • Adaptable a empresas con múltiples objetivos en su organización, dentro de una misma granja.
  • Aislamiento de datos de servicio.
  • Permite que los equipos de trabajo o departamentos se administren los servicios dedicados a ellos.
  • Los sitios pueden ser configurados para utilizar un conjunto de aplicaciones de servicio.

►Inconvenientes:

  • Mayor complejidad para configurar y administrar.
  • Los recursos de la granja soportan múltiples instancias de algunos servicios.

►Recomendaciones:

  • Esta configuración funciona bien para empresas con departamentos o equipos de trabajo que requieran de servicios dedicados o aislamiento de procesos, o de sitios que se establezcan relaciones de negocio más estrechas, como puedan ser Partners de colaboración.
  • Los servicios comúnmente desplegados para uso dedicado por equipos de trabajo individuales o departamentos son:
    • Servicios de Excel, para la optimización del rendimiento de los informes de Excel.
    • Servicio de metadatos administrados, que permiten a los departamentos gestionar sus propias taxonomía, jerarquías, palabras, etc.
    • Servicio de conectividad a datos profesionales, que permiten a los departamentos gestionar sus propios sistemas de datos de líneas de negocio, manteniendo los datos aislados del resto de la organización.

image

image

Comentarios

Aún no hay comentarios sobre esta entrada de blog.
Los elementos de esta lista requieren aprobación de contenido. El envío no aparecerá en las vistas públicas hasta que haya sido aprobado por un usuario con los derechos adecuados. Obtener más información sobre la aprobación de contenido.

Título


Cuerpo *


Datos adjuntos